Episode 153 – Surviving the Dearth: Feeding, Fighting Robbers, and Managing Mites

Beekeeping For Newbees®

The nectar flow doesn't last forever, and when it ends, things can get tough. In this episode, we talk about how to recognize the start of a summer dearth, how to feed bees without triggering robbing, and how to use this broodless period to crush your mite population. You'll also hear what not to do with syrup feeders (Jeff's mistake was gross), and why hive beetles and robbing go hand in hand this time of year.

What’s Inside This Episode:

  • Signs your bees have entered a dearth
  • When to feed — and how to do it without attracting robbers
  • Entrance reducers: size matters
  • Best feeder styles (and how to avoid fermenting syrup disasters)
  • Hive beetle traps, pollen patty caution, and SHB vacuums
  • Leveraging the brood break for more effective mite treatments
  • Why blind treating for mites without testing is hurting your bees (and everyone else)
  • How to recognize robbing in action — and how to shut it down fast
